Choosing a Cyber Risk Rating and Monitoring Platform

Organizations increasingly depend on external vendors, cloud providers, software companies, and service partners to operate efficiently. That interconnectedness also expands the potential attack surface. A weakness at a supplier can create consequences for an organization that has otherwise invested heavily in its own security controls. NIST’s cybersecurity supply chain guidance emphasizes the need to identify, assess, and mitigate risks throughout interconnected technology supply chains rather than treating supplier security as a one-time procurement exercise.

Cyber risk rating and third-party monitoring platforms can help security and risk teams maintain visibility into those external dependencies. However, selecting a platform requires more than comparing headline scores. Organizations should examine the quality of underlying data, monitoring depth, risk context, workflow capabilities, scalability, and how effectively the platform supports actual business decisions.

Start With the Risk Questions the Platform Must Answer

The first step is defining what the organization needs to understand about its third parties. A security rating can provide a useful high-level signal, but a single grade rarely explains why a supplier presents risk or what should happen next. Effective third-party risk management requires enough context to distinguish a minor technical issue from an exposure that could materially affect business operations.

For example, a platform should help answer questions about vulnerabilities, exposed services, compromised credentials, security controls, threat activity, historical incidents, and changes in a vendor’s external posture. It should also make it possible to prioritize suppliers according to business criticality rather than treating every vendor equally.

This distinction matters because NIST’s 2026 Due Diligence Assessment Quick-Start Guide identifies areas such as resilience, foundational cyber practices, provenance, foreign ownership or influence, and supply-chain tiers as relevant considerations in supplier due diligence. A strong monitoring platform should therefore complement broader due diligence rather than attempt to reduce the entire supplier assessment to one number.

Compare Data Quality, Ratings, and Monitoring Depth

When assessing security ratings platform comparison, organizations should look beyond the appearance of their dashboards and examine how each platform produces and contextualizes risk information. Security ratings are useful when they are consistent, explainable, and connected to underlying findings. More importantly, users should be able to investigate the factors driving a score and determine whether a change represents a meaningful business concern.

Black Kite describes its rating methodology as covering multiple risk categories and combining those findings into a 1–100 cyber rating and A–F grade. Its platform also highlights additional indicators, including ransomware susceptibility and historical breach-related measurements. SecurityScorecard, meanwhile, continues to provide A-to-F security ratings while positioning its broader platform around continuous monitoring, threat intelligence, automated assessments, and third-party risk workflows.

The practical comparison, therefore, is not simply which platform produces the better-looking score. It is whether the underlying signals are sufficiently accurate, timely, attributable, and actionable for the organization’s risk model. Teams should test how quickly new exposures appear, how false positives are handled, how findings are explained, and whether historical trends can be reviewed.

Examine Third-Party and Extended-Supply-Chain Visibility

The scope of monitoring is another major differentiator. A platform may provide strong visibility into a direct supplier while offering limited insight into the suppliers, technologies, and dependencies behind that organization. Yet a company’s exposure can extend beyond its immediate contractual relationships.

For organizations evaluating black kite vs. securityscorecard, it is useful to examine how each platform handles vendor discovery, fourth-party relationships, concentration risk, and changes across interconnected ecosystems. Black Kite currently emphasizes visibility into third-, fourth-, and fifth-party relationships, while SecurityScorecard’s current platform describes automated discovery of third- and fourth-party vendors as part of its supply-chain capabilities.

The objective should not be collecting the largest possible number of vendor records. Instead, the platform should help security teams identify dependencies that could create meaningful concentration or cascading risk. A cloud provider shared by several critical suppliers, for example, may deserve more attention than an isolated low-impact vendor.

Evaluate Workflow, Prioritization, and Response Capabilities

Monitoring only creates value when teams can act on what they discover. A platform should therefore be assessed according to how easily findings move from detection to investigation, communication, remediation, and ongoing verification.

When comparing providers, teams should consider:

  • Alert quality: Can the platform distinguish significant changes from routine noise?
  • Prioritization: Can findings be ranked according to business impact, vendor criticality, and threat context?
  • Vendor engagement: Can security teams communicate findings and track remediation without relying heavily on disconnected spreadsheets and email?
  • Integrations: Can information flow into existing GRC, SIEM, ticketing, procurement, or security workflows?
  • Reporting: Can technical findings be translated into concise reports for executives, boards, auditors, and procurement teams?
  • These capabilities become particularly important as a vendor portfolio grows. SecurityScorecard’s current platform, for example, combines continuous monitoring with assessments, vendor interactions, threat intelligence, and remediation workflows. Black Kite similarly describes monitoring, assessment, vendor engagement, threat intelligence, and financial-risk capabilities within its broader platform.

    The key evaluation question is whether those capabilities fit the organization’s existing operating model. A feature-rich platform can still be ineffective if analysts cannot integrate its findings into established risk-management processes.

    Consider Business Context, Compliance, and Risk Quantification

    Technical findings become more useful when they can be connected to business consequences. A vulnerable internet-facing system may be important, but its priority changes significantly if it supports a supplier responsible for a mission-critical process or sensitive data.

    Risk teams should therefore examine whether a platform supports vendor criticality classifications, business context, regulatory requirements, financial impact, and evidence collection. These capabilities can help security leaders communicate risk beyond technical teams.

    This is also consistent with NIST’s current approach to supply-chain risk management, which emphasizes documenting systems, responsibilities, controls, interconnected environments, and risk-management decisions. Monitoring platforms should support that broader governance process rather than operate as isolated security-rating tools.

    Compliance support deserves similar scrutiny. Organizations should determine whether findings can be mapped to relevant frameworks, whether evidence can be retained for audits, and whether the platform can demonstrate changes over time. SecurityScorecard, for instance, describes capabilities for mapping third-party oversight to standards such as ISO 27001.

    Test Accuracy, Usability, and Long-Term Fit

    A realistic evaluation should include a controlled proof of concept using the organization’s actual vendor portfolio. Select a representative group of suppliers across different industries, sizes, risk levels, and technology profiles. Then compare the platforms using identical evaluation criteria.

    Pay particular attention to attribution accuracy. A platform that incorrectly associates an exposed asset with the wrong company can generate unnecessary investigations and undermine confidence in its findings. Likewise, a platform that produces extensive alerts without effective prioritization can overwhelm a small security team.

    Usability also matters. Analysts should be able to move from an overall rating to the underlying evidence without excessive navigation. Executives should receive concise risk summaries, while technical teams should have enough detail to investigate individual findings. The platform should accommodate changes in vendor populations, organizational structure, regulatory expectations, and internal risk appetite.

    Cost should be evaluated in the same context. The relevant question is not simply the subscription price but the total operational value, including implementation, integrations, analyst time, vendor engagement, reporting, and ongoing administration.

    End Note

    Choosing a cyber risk rating and monitoring platform is ultimately a risk-management decision rather than a contest between security scores. Ratings can provide an efficient way to prioritize attention, but effective third-party oversight depends on the quality of evidence behind those ratings and the organization’s ability to translate findings into action.

    The strongest evaluation process considers data accuracy, monitoring frequency, extended-supply-chain visibility, prioritization, workflow integration, reporting, compliance support, and scalability. Organizations should also test competing platforms against real suppliers and real operational requirements before making a decision. By focusing on how well a platform supports informed risk decisions—not simply how many features it lists—security leaders can build a third-party monitoring capability that remains useful as their digital ecosystem becomes more complex.
